Our verdict is Pathogenic. Variant got 18 ACMG points: 18P and 0B. PVS1PM2PP5_Very_Strong
The NM_001170629.2(CHD8):c.1744C>T(p.Arg582*) variant causes a stop gained change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ely pathogenic (★★). Variant results in nonsense mediated mRNA decay.

Intellectual developmental disorder with autism and macrocephaly Pathogenic:2
Inheritance: The variant was identified in the Heterozygous state in the sample. Frequency: The variant is absent from the gnomAD reference population dataset. Variant type: Null variant in a gene where loss of function is a known mechanism of disease. Predicted to undergo NMD. Summary: Taken together, we interpret this variant to be Pathogenic.(PVS1, PM2, PS4_P) -
